K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S:
Supervise and render general clerical support services within the Medico-Legal
Component.
Record, organize, store, capture and retrieve correspondence, data and records.
Update and keep registers and statistics.
Co-ordinate management and control of diaries and rosters.
Handle and communicate routine enquiries/correspondence/telephone calls effectively.
Make Photocopies and retrieve or send facsimiles and e-mails.
Compile and distribute documents/packages to various stakeholders as required.
Keep and maintain the filing system for the Medico-Legal Component.
Type letters and/or other correspondences as and when required.
Keep and maintain the incoming and outgoing document registers of the Medico-Legal
Component.
Supervise and provide supply chain clerical support services within the Medico-Legal
Component.
Liaise with internal and external stakeholders in relation to procurement of goods and
services.
Obtain quotations and complete procurement forms for the purchasing of standard office
items.
Ensure control, maintenance and safekeeping of stock, office stationery and equipment.
Keep and maintain asset register and borrowing book for unit(s), where necessary.
Supervise and provide personnel administration and clerical support services within the
Medico-Legal Component.
Organize and maintain EPMDS documents and records, e.g. Job Descriptions,
Performance Agreements, Performance Reviews, Performance Assessments, etc.
Maintain leave and attendance registers, including arrangement of travelling and
accommodation and maintenance of personnel records in the Medico-Legal Component.
Supervise and provide financial administration support services in the Medico-Legal
Component.
Prepare, capture and update expenditure in the Medico-Legal Component, including NSIs,
etc.
Supervise administrative clerks within the Medico-Legal Component.in terms of the above
listed KPAs.
Ensure provision of quality administrative support work for the clinicians.
Apply discipline and mange staff performance through EPMDS.
